linux unzip命令

我记得有一次我在公司服务器上处理一个项目文件。
文件太大。
我使用 zip 命令对其进行压缩并将结果保存为 .zip 文件。
但项目组的新同事小王不知道如何压缩这个文件。
我说的是Linux系统下可以使用unzip命令解压。
他按照我的要求做了,但仍然有问题。
我去查看是因为他忘记设置解压目录了。
我当时就说过,在使用unzip命令时,可以通过添加-d参数来指定解压到某个目录。
小王按照我的建议再次尝试,终于成功了。
稍等一下,如果是第一次接触Linux系统,对unzip命令的参数不太熟悉。
好吧我得找时间给他详细解释一下各个参数的作用了。

Linux下用gzip和unzip命令来压缩和解压文件的用法

Gzip压缩文件:gzip -c 文件名 > 文件名.gz。
要查看压缩文件的内容,gzip:gzip -l filename.gz。
gzip 压缩文件:gunzip filename.gz。
解压zip文件解压:unzip myfile.zip。
unzip指定解压路径:unzip myfile.zip -d /path/to/directory。
解压查看未压缩的信息:unzip -l myfile.zip。

Linux下用gzip和unzip命令来压缩和解压文件的用法

gzip:解压文件,语法:gzip [-acfhlLnNqrtvV][-s][文件...]或gzip [-acfhlLnNqrtvV][-s][目录],用途:解压gzip压缩文件,扩展名默认为.gz。

unzip:解压zip文件,语法:unzip [-cflptuvz][-agCjLMnoqsVX][-P][.zip file][file][-d][-x],用途:解压zip格式的压缩文件。

示例: 1 、gzip解压文件:gzip -dv file.tar.gz(解压并查看进程,不会覆盖原文件)。
2 .gzip解压目录:gzip -d目录/(递归解压目录)。
3 . 将zip文件解压到指定目录:unzip -d /path/to/dir file.zip。
4 . Unzip 列出 zip 文件的内容:unzip -l file.zip。

注意:gzip不能直接解压目录,必须先打包。
-j解压参数可以避免重建目录结构。